有两个单选按钮A,B,另又一个文字链接,要求选A时,链接有效,选B时,链接无效.请问如何实现?
<br>
<INPUT TYPE="radio" NAME="a" onclick=document.links[0].href='http://www.csdn.net'>有效
<INPUT TYPE="radio" NAME="b"  onclick=document.links[0].href='#'>无效<br>
<a href='#'> 连接 </a>

解决方案 »

  1.   

    方法二 :)有两个单选按钮A,B,另又一个文字链接,要求选A时,链接有效,选B时,链接无效.请问如何实现?
    <br>
    <INPUT TYPE="radio" NAME="a">有效
    <INPUT TYPE="radio" NAME="b">无效<br>
    <a href='#' onclick="if(a.checked){window.location='http://www.pig.com'}else{return false;}"> 连接 </a>
      

  2.   

    <script language=Javascript>
    function clickRadio(str)
    {
      if(str=="a"){
        document.all.link1.innerHTML="<a href='#'>link1</a>";
      }
      if(str=="b"){
        document.all.link1.innerHTML="<a href='http://www.google.com'>link1</a>";
      }
    }
    </script><span id=link1><a href="#">link1</a></span>
    <FORM METHOD=POST name=form1 ACTION="">
    <INPUT TYPE="radio" NAME="radio1" value="a" onclick="clickRadio(this.value);">a
    <INPUT TYPE="radio" NAME="radio1" value="b" onclick="clickRadio(this.value);">b
    </FORM>
      

  3.   

    感谢goldenlove(潇洒.net),xhbmj(我右边有★★★★★)!感谢大家!
    学习中...